-- ? Vtec Controller ? --

Hey Guys:
Some one told me That I should install a Vtec Controller on my 02CL. I have no Idea what one does, How it works or anything. What I really want to know though, is if putting a Vtec controller on my car is a bunch of bull shit and a waste of time. Does it give any sort of gain?

Let me Know guys. Thanx

It's only worth it if your engine has mods, like exhaust, pullies, intake, etc.

The VAFC-II is pretty popular, that's what I have. But it's already pretuned for the things listed above. A vtec controller is good to tune your car with, and enables you to adjust vtec engagement, you're not going to notice any real gain without a tune though
